Keep your drum brakes operating quietly and consistently with the Carlson Drum Brake Hardware Kit 17353. It installs as a direct-fit replacement for the 1994-2001 Kia Sephia [All] and the 2000-2004 Kia Spectra [All], supplying the small hardware that keeps the shoes located and returning properly.

The kit bundles a variety of drum-brake hardware — items such as anti-rattle clips, seals, pins, dust boots, shoe return springs, hold-down springs, and adjuster assemblies — that help maintain consistent, balanced braking. Because springs and clips lose tension over time, industry practice is to replace this hardware whenever the brake shoes are serviced.
